When should I use Vecteezy vs VectoSolve?
Use Vecteezy when you need pre-made stock vectors (icons, illustrations, templates). Use VectoSolve when you need to convert YOUR own images to vectors — logos, custom designs, photos, illustrations. Different tools for different needs.
